City of Austin Housing Finance Corporation Board of Directors met Sept. 21.
Here are the minutes provided by the board:
The Board of Directors of the Austin Housing Finance Corporation (AHFC Board) was convened on Thursday, September 21, 2023, in the Council Chambers of City Hall, 301 West 2nd Street, Austin, Texas, and via videoconference. The following items were considered by the AHFC Board.
President Watson called the meeting to order at 11:11 a.m. Director Fuentes appeared via videoconference.
CONSENT AGENDA
The following items were acted on by one motion.
AHFC1. Approve an inducement resolution related to an application for private activity bond financing that authorizes an allocation of up to $26,000,000 in private activity volume cap multi-family non-recourse bonds to Foundation Communities, Inc., or an affiliated entity, for a proposed affordable multi-family development to be known as Mary Lee Square Phase I, located at or near 1326, 1328, 1332, and 1342 Lamar Square Drive, Austin, Texas 78704. District(s) Affected: District 9.
Resolution No. 20230921-AHFC001 was approved on consent on Director Harper-Madison’s motion, Vice President Ellis’ second without objection.
AHFC2. Approve an inducement resolution related to an application for private activity bond financing that authorizes an allocation of up to $25,000,000 in private activity volume cap multi-family non-recourse bonds to Pleasant Valley LP, or an affiliated entity, for a proposed affordable multifamily development located at or near 5900 South Pleasant Valley Road, Austin, Texas 78744. District(s) Affected: District 2.
Resolution No. 20230921-AHFC002 was approved on consent on Director Harper-Madison’s motion, Vice President Ellis’ second on a 10-1 vote. Director Kelly voted nay.
AHFC3. Approve an inducement resolution related to an application for private activity bond financing that authorizes an allocation of up to the greater of 1.7 percent of the state ceiling or $50,000,000 in private activity volume cap multi-family non-recourse bonds to Austin Leased Housing Associates V, LLLP or an affiliated entity, for a proposed affordable multi-family development to be known as Sage at Franklin Park, located at or near 4500 Nuckols Crossing Road, Austin, Texas 78744. District(s) Affected: District 2.
Resolution No. 20230921-AHFC003 was approved on consent on Director Harper-Madison’s motion, Vice President Ellis’ second on a 10-1 vote. Director Kelly voted nay.
AHFC4. Authorize negotiation and execution of an amendment to the agreement with the Ending Community Homelessness Coalition for providing Permanent Supportive Housing and Rapid Rehousing consulting services, to extend the term of the agreement through September 30, 2023, and include an additional $100,000, for a total amount not to exceed $400,000. The motion to authorize negotiation and execution of an amendment to the agreement with the Ending Community Homelessness Coalition was approved on consent on Director Harper-Madison’s motion, Vice President Ellis’ second on a 10-1 vote. Director Kelly voted nay.
President Watson adjourned the meeting at 11:23 a.m. without objection.
